Bukka I: Vijayanagara's First Ambassador to China

Bukka I, the early ruler of the Vijayanagara Empire, sent a formal diplomatic ambassador to the Ming dynasty emperor of China in 1374 to promote trade and relations.

Concept


Vijayanagara was a globally connected empire. Its early rulers sought to bypass intermediaries and establish direct diplomatic and commercial links with the great powers of the East, specifically the Ming dynasty in China.

Authentic Source Evidence


Bukka I (reigned 1356–1377) sent an embassy to the Chinese Emperor of the Ming dynasty in 1374. This mission, led by an envoy named Gangaram, was intended to open regular trade channels and recognize mutual sovereignty. Records show the Chinese emperor was highly impressed and returned the gesture with gifts.

Analytical Breakdown


  • Logic 1: This was the first time a Hindu ruler of South India established formal diplomatic contact with China, marking a new era of maritime diplomacy.

  • Logic 2: While Krishnadeva Raya was more famous for Western trade (Portuguese), it was the early Sangama ruler Bukka I who pioneered Eastern diplomacy.
